Roan Cottage is a delightful semi-detached barn conversion located in Swindon, Wiltshire, just a short drive from the charming market town of Royal Wootton Bassett. This property, set on a working beef cattle farm, accommodates up to four guests in its two well-appointed bedrooms, making it an ideal choice for families or friends seeking a relaxing getaway. The cottage features a double room, a twin room, and a convenient shower room, all situated on the ground floor for easy accessibility. The open-plan living area combines a kitchen, dining space, and sitting area, promoting a cozy and communal atmosphere.
Outside, guests can enjoy a shared, enclosed lawned garden complete with outdoor furniture, perfect for alfresco dining in the picturesque surroundings of the southern Cotswold Hills. The cottage also provides off-road parking for two vehicles and secure storage for bicycles, catering to those who wish to explore the beautiful countryside. One well-behaved dog is welcome, allowing pet owners to include their furry friends in the holiday experience. However, due to the presence of livestock on the farm, dogs must be kept on a lead when outdoors.
Roan Cottage is well-equipped with modern amenities to ensure a comfortable stay, including wall-mounted electric heaters, heated towel rails, and various kitchen appliances such as an electric oven, microwave, and dishwasher. Entertainment options are also provided, with a TV featuring Freeview, a DVD player, and a selection of books and games available for guests. Essential items like bed linen, towels, a hairdryer, and an iron are included in the rental, while additional conveniences like a travel cot and highchair are available upon request. The property is also suitable for individuals with limited mobility, thanks to its ramped access and wide doors.
